Popular Bracelet Stack Outfit Ideas to Try
1. The Mixed Metal Stack
Combine gold, silver, and rose gold bangles and cuffs for a versatile stack that complements nearly every outfit color. This is the easiest entry point for beginners and photographs beautifully under natural light.
2. The Boho Bead Stack<n
Layer wooden beads, turquoise stones, woven threads, and charm bracelets for a festival-ready look. Pair with linen sets, flowy maxi dresses, or distressed denim to amplify the bohemian vibe.
3. The Minimalist Thin Bangle Stack
Stack three to five delicate bangles in similar tones for a clean, modern aesthetic. This style pairs perfectly with monochrome outfits, tailored blazers, and capsule wardrobe staples.
4. The Statement Cuff Stack
Anchor your stack with one bold cuff and surround it with thinner bracelets for balance. This works wonderfully with sleeveless tops, strapless dresses, and any look where the wrist becomes the hero.
5. The Charm and Personalization Stack
Mix initial bracelets, zodiac charms, and meaningful pieces to tell a personal story. This approach is highly shareable because viewers connect emotionally with curated, meaningful accessories.

Tips and Strategies for Filming Bracelet Stack Content
Great bracelet stack outfit ideas deserve great visuals. Follow these production tips to make your wrist game camera-ready.
Lighting and Background
Soft, natural light from a window brings out the texture of beads, the shine of metals, and the color of stones. Avoid harsh overhead lighting that creates unflattering shadows. A clean, neutral background keeps the focus on the accessories.
Wrist Positioning and Movement
Angle the wrist so the stack is fully visible during transitions. Gentle wrist rolls, hand-on-hip poses, and reaching for objects all create natural movement that catches light and adds dynamism to your video.</n<,
Nail and Outfit Coordination
Your manicure should complement, not compete with, the bracelet stack. Neutral nails work with bold stacks, while a pop of color can energize minimalist stacks. Coordinate your outfit palette so the stack feels intentional rather than accidental.

What are the best bracelet stack outfit ideas for beginners?
Start with a minimalist thin bangle stack in gold or silver. Three to five matching bangles create a clean, polished look that pairs with virtually any outfit. Once you are comfortable, experiment with mixed metals or add a single statement cuff for personality.
How do I make my bracelet stack stand out in fashion videos?
Film in soft natural light, angle your wrist toward the camera, and use gentle hand movements to catch the light. Pair your stack with contrasting outfit textures, like a chunky knit or linen, to make the jewelry pop on screen.
